No failures or monitoring site problems were encountered during 2013 and no compliance limits <br />were exceeded in 2013. <br />Values of total suspended solids (TSS) were generally on the low side of ranges observed in <br />previous years. Total dissolved solids (TDS) were generally in an indirect relationship with flow rate <br />when adequate flow occurred at a site to determine the relationship. The TDS of the surface water <br />from the mine area is similar to the TDS from the non -mined area and, therefore, an increase has not <br />been defined, except for an increase in TDS during low flow conditions at NPDES sites 001 and 011. <br />The IDS, conductivity and major constituents varied over expected ranges with an increase in values <br />as ground -water flow to the stream becomes a larger portion of the total flow. The SAR values <br />measured in 2013 were within the natural ranges for this site. Other chemical constituents analyzed <br />from samples collected from the surface water sites showed little change. The variations and <br />magnitude in iron concentration observed in 2013 were typical of natural values for these sites. The <br />total aluminum concentrations observed in 2013 were similar to concentrations observed in previous <br />years. The remainder of the minor constituents measured in 2013 are low and within natural ranges. <br />Monitoring data indicates that Trapper Mine sediment control structures prevented any significant <br />impacts on the surface water systems downgradient of the mine in 2013. <br />Trapper Mining Company 6-6 <br />2013 Annual Report <br />
